I hate rating something one star, I really do. However, I have spent the last week trying to find SOMETHING positive to say about these pedals, and I really can't. I purchased a NordicTrack S22i in the beginning of the winter, I threw on a pair of Shimano XTR pedals I had, realizing it was total overkill and I would need something more spin bike appropriate come spring. I ordered these primarily due to the duel cleat option, thinking these would fit the bill for my indoor bike.Unfortunately, when they arrived they lacked the SPD system on the underside of the pedal, even though the documentation in the box displayed said system. I figured this was just a mistake and sent them back for replacement, however when the replacements arrived they are just the same (see photo).I decided to try them out with just the Look Delta. I installed the pedals and delta cleats, my first spin and my foot was flying all over the place, not just the back was loose, but the toe as well. I adjusted the release tension as high as it would go, which helped only minimally. My foot slides around all over, way more than normal float.Lastly the rotation of these pedals is tight. I thought it would loosen after some use, but they haven't. the idea of a road cleat pedal is the rear portion of the pedal is heaver than the toe portion, thus it is always pointing down, so you can toe-in to engage the pedal. These being tight the pedal does not rotate on it's own thus is upside down through half the arc. (see photo). One of the pedals (right) has a "click" you can feel with each pedal stroke, which leads me to think these will not last long (not that they are going to have a chance, I used one week and I am done)I can't in any way endorse these pedals, Do not buy.

Super affordable pedal option for Look replacement. These work perfectly to replace my old worn out Look pedals from the 2000s. My Bianchi Veloce came with some Celeste Look pedals and they have seen better days. These appear better made and should last a long time but they are about 50% heavier. Fit is the same as Look and the tension adjustment works just as well. I noticed no difference in feel and the bearings are smooth and well lubricated. They look nice and perform very well!
